Output f844e64d3141384589a2fe68942a7565abbb4c7f59afec8ce22d22456d44fa85:1

value
44768000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f9065882a94b50b5f7c617e958c563e88a5fdf OP_EQUALVERIFY OP_CHECKSIG
address
1MEgewXbtXuL5rVpLjfuPzEcoA4YYsRuEA
transaction
f844e64d3141384589a2fe68942a7565abbb4c7f59afec8ce22d22456d44fa85
spent
true